The Ahmedabad Urban Development Authority (AUDA) has begun work on the third and final phase of the city’s ring road network - a new 300-feet-wide outer ring road being built at a cost of approximately ₹2,200 crore, with completion targeted by December 2027. This will run alongside Ahmedabad’s existing two ring roads: the inner ring road (within Ahmedabad Municipal Corporation limits) and the current Sardar Patel (S.P.) Ring Road that has served the city since 2004.
The new ring road’s official village list confirms Kasindra as one of the locations directly along its alignment, alongside other emerging belt areas like Changodar, Moraiya, Jetalpur, Sanand, and Shela. The project is designed with service roads on either side, flyovers, road under bridges, grade separators, and stormwater drainage — essentially a full-scale modern highway corridor, not just a road widening exercise.
In parallel, AUDA has also floated tenders worth approximately ₹2,200 crore to widen the existing 76 km S.P. Ring Road from 4 lanes to 6 lanes, split into an eastern stretch (~37 km) and a western stretch (~39 km) - the very road that already runs close to Kasindra today.
Kasindra is now positioned near both the existing S.P. Ring Road (being widened to 6 lanes) and the new outer ring road being built through it. Very few residential micro-markets in Ahmedabad sit at the intersection of two ring-road corridors at the same time.
Once complete, the new ring road is expected to ease traffic load significantly — the existing S.P. Ring Road alone currently carries close to a lakh vehicle a day. Wider lanes, dedicated service roads, and grade separators mean shorter, more predictable commute times from Kasindra to Prahladnagar, SG Highway, Sanand, and the rest of Ahmedabad.
Kasindra currently sits just outside AUDA’s jurisdiction. With major infrastructure now being routed directly through the area, its inclusion within AUDA limits is expected sooner rather than later — a shift that historically tends to boost both civic infrastructure and property values in newly included zones.
The new ring road is being planned alongside the Delhi-Mumbai Freight Corridor alignment, with logistics zones planned near Godhavi and surrounding villages. This means Kasindra isn’t just gaining a residential advantage — it’s becoming part of a larger industrial and logistics growth corridor, which typically drives long-term demand for housing nearby.
